The name of the bones that protect our lungs, heart, and kidneys are called the?
A- Vertebrae and Phalanges
B- Cardiac and Smooth
C- Crainium and Mandible
D- Sternum and Ribs

The correct answer would be "D" as the sternum and ribs are the main source of protection to vital organs. The sternum, (the breastbone) stabilizes the thoracic skeleton and the ribs serve as the connected "cage" for vitals.
